Description:

 

The CCARC is a group of Federal Communication Commission (FCC) licensed amateur radio operators, which promote emergency communications in times of disaster and other emergency services for the community.

The CCARC is an ARRL-affiliated club committed to the advancement of amateur radio through education and community support. 

CCARC is a charitable organization in Lawton, Oklahoma, and was granted tax-exempt status (501C3) by the IRS in November 2021.  

We focus on disaster preparedness and relief services, specifically on emergency communication support for Amateur Radio Emergency Services (ARES) and Community Emergency Response Team (CERT) organizations.

We provide computer and tablet (online) amateur radio testing programs through W5YI-VEC and ARRL-VEC organizations conducted in Lawton, Oklahoma, and surrounding areas.
